There is really no secrets to the front end. I like to use a small dab of Trinity Red stuff grease on each king pin. The L4 pins are pretty smooth right out of the box. The only place you want to make sure they really smooth is the pin sliding through the lower arm ball.
Not really a dimension to go by. Just set the shims (on top) so there is little to no droop.
The best thing you can do is make sure when you build the front is to make sure both sides have equal ride height. Most of the you need a thin shim under the lower a-arm on one side of the car to make it even.
